1. The best age for women to have children

Due to the differences between our yellow race's physical fitness, environment, diet and other factors compared to other races, China generally recommends that the best childbearing age for women is between 23 and 30 years old. This also takes into account the personal health of women of this age. Because if a woman is healthy, in her 20s, and has not gotten pregnant for a year without taking any contraceptive measures, there is generally no need to worry. However, if a woman is over 30 and has not gotten pregnant after 6 months without any contraceptive methods, she should consult a doctor for details.
